You are viewing the CopperCoins catalog page for 1987D•1MM•013, a documented Lincoln cent die variety. This listing is cataloged as a Repunched Mint Mark, from 1987, and struck at the Denver Mint. It is recorded as D/D Tilted. Below you will find 1 stage of identification photos and markers, catalog cross references, and reported values for coins minted with this die.

Die Notes

A nice strong split in the lower serif shows on this variety.

Obverse: A NE-SW die scratch to the left of the 9 of the date. Light die scratches through the top of the ART of LIBERTY. Light NE-SW die scratches under GOD.

Reverse: Light die scratches run SE from PLURIBUS with a heavier scratch under the second U of PLURIBUS. Multiple die scratches above the NE of ONE with a longer scratch from the field to the top of the E of ONE. Reverse is MDS.
